Judge Mathis wants black men to turn the tv off and support black women.
Honorable Judge Greg Mathis Sr. has a call to action for the Black Man. The well-known TV personality posted a clip of one of his recent speeches on Instagram. The captioned the post,
“I’m going to say it again. as Black men, we must love, protect and serve our community. anything else is unacceptable”
In the video he addressed issues in the black community;
“The majority of the Black Lives Matter Marches were black women and white kids while our black men sat back and killed each other. Falling into this trap that they have set for us by failing us in our education systems, bringing in guns, and sending out the jobs. And you chumps are going for it like a bunch of suckers. And your supposed to be cool you’re supposed to be the man. Naw you ain’t no man! You’re a punk until you stand up and fight for your women.”
Judge Greg Mathis is known for keeping it real on his daytime Emmy-winning syndicated reality courtroom show, Judge Mathis. The Detroit Native has been an arbitrator on the Judge Mathis Show since 1999. He received his Star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ame this year.
As previously reported, The retired Michigan 36th District Court Judge also has a reality show with his family, Mathis Family Matters. The show airs every Sunday on E! The docu-series shows the life of Greg, 62, and Linda Mathis, 59, as they parent their four adult children. Jade, 37, Camara, 34, Greg, 33, and Amir, 32.
